#6db6e4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6db6e4 is composed of 42.7% red, 71.4%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.2% cyan, 20.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 203.2 degrees, a saturation of 68.8% and a lightness of 66.1%. #6db6e4 color hex could be obtained by blending #daffff with #006dc9.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#6db6e4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6db6e4 has RGB values of R:109, G:182, B:228 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0.2,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 7190244.
